Mary Sue and Larry have a lay apostolate in their home town of Westmont, Illinois operating from the DuPage Marian Center.
In 1994 Mary Sue and Larry talked about the importance of Our Lady in the Catholic faith and the necessity in our day and age to practice and encourage true family values.
Unfortunately no recording was made of this session.